Yono Games Monetization Tactics Explained
Yono Games, recognized for their hyper-casual titles, have developed a reputation for effective monetization techniques. While the core gameplay is often simple, the underlying mechanics are engineered to encourage player commitment. One primary technique is the frequent showing of rewarded video advertisements, offering small in-game rewards for seeing them. Furthermore, Yono Games typically employs a capped energy mechanic, requiring players to pause or buy refills, a classic progression model. The chance of valuable items or characters is regularly gated behind costly currency, incentivizing recurring purchases. This mix of rewarded video commercials, energy controls, and premium content forms the foundation of Yono Games' income generation.
